I am not familiar with the Australian Shepard, but the Boarder Collie is hard to beat. The are a BORN cow dog. Without training they'll gather up the chickens, get all the cows in one corner of the pasture, etc. Untrained dogs are a problem when there's a deffinate gate, etc. you want the cows to go through. The untrained dog gets very excited, and the cows are going to move, it just may not be where you want them to go.
Also the Boarder Collie's sweet temperment is second to none.
